How the Rice Yield Calculation Works
Rice roughly triples in volume and weight when cooked. This calculator uses a standard conversion ratio of 1:3 (uncooked to cooked weight). For every 100 grams of dry, uncooked rice, you can expect approximately 300 grams of cooked rice. This ratio applies to most common long-grain white rice varieties.
The calculation is straightforward: Cooked Rice Weight = Uncooked Rice Weight × 3. This formula provides a reliable estimate for meal planning and recipe scaling.

Understanding Your Results
The output is an estimate, not a precise guarantee. Actual yield can vary based on several factors:
- Rice type: Brown rice, jasmine, basmati, and short-grain varieties absorb water differently, which affects final weight.
- Cooking method: Absorption methods (stovetop, rice cooker) versus boiling and draining produce different yields.
- Cooking time: Overcooking can cause more water absorption, increasing weight slightly.
- Rinsing: Pre-rinsing removes surface starch, which can marginally affect water absorption.
For most standard white rice cooked using the absorption method, the 1:3 ratio is accurate within ±10%.

Common Mistakes to Avoid
- Assuming all rice types behave identically: Brown rice typically yields less (around 2.5x), while sticky rice can yield more (up to 3.5x).
- Confusing volume with weight: 1 cup of dry rice weighs approximately 185g, but this varies by grain size and packing. Always use weight for accuracy.
- Ignoring rinsing weight: If you rinse rice before cooking, the water retained on the grains adds weight. Weigh rice dry before rinsing for the most accurate input.

FAQ
Does the ratio change for brown rice?
Yes. Brown rice typically absorbs less water than white rice. A more accurate ratio for brown rice is approximately 1:2.5 (uncooked to cooked weight). For best results, use a ratio of 2.5x for brown rice instead of 3x.
Is the ratio the same for volume (cups)?
Roughly, but volume is less precise. 1 cup of dry white rice yields about 3 cups of cooked rice. However, grain size, shape, and how tightly the rice is packed in the cup can cause variation. Weight measurements are significantly more reliable.
Why did my rice yield less than the calculator predicted?
Several factors can reduce yield: using brown or parboiled rice, cooking with a method that drains water, shorter cooking times, or older rice that has lost moisture. If you consistently get lower yields, try increasing your water ratio slightly or adjusting your cooking time.
Can I use this calculator for wild rice or mixed rice blends?
Wild rice and blends containing multiple grain types have variable absorption rates. The standard 1:3 ratio is a starting point, but actual yield may differ. For blends, check the package instructions for the recommended water ratio, as this directly correlates to final cooked weight.
